On the weekend the authorities lowered the alert status from high to the lower level and people happily returned to their villages on the slopes. And yesterday a large eruption of searing hot gas and debris sent more than 1,000 villagers fleeing from the slopes of Indonesia's Gunung Merapi prompting authorities to raise the volcano's alert level to its highest status - once more.

The highest alert means thousands of people will have to be evacuated again. This is a great exercise in time and motion!. It reminds me of that old adage - 'I don't know whether I'm coming or going'.
Apparently clouds of hot ash travelled 3 kilometres down the slopes on the Magelang side sending everyone into another panic. The volcano also threw up massive heat clouds for a half an hour over a maximum distance of seven kilometres towards the Gendol River in the Yogyakarta district of Sleman.
